what attracts centipede

Pest Control

The answer to 'what attracts centipede' is that centipedes are attracted to damp, dark, and humid environments. They thrive in areas with high moisture content, such as basements, bathrooms, and crawl spaces. Centipedes feed on other small insects and arthropods, so the presence of their prey can also draw them indoors.

Centipedes are typically nocturnal and prefer to hide in cracks, crevices, and under objects during the day. They may also be attracted to homes with rotting wood, excess clutter, or poor sanitation, as these conditions provide ideal habitats and food sources.

Step-by-Step Guide

  1. 1

    Identify the problem

    Inspect your home for signs of centipedes, such as the insects themselves, their shed exoskeletons, or any damage they've caused.

  2. 2

    Reduce moisture and eliminate food sources

    Fix any leaks, improve ventilation, and eliminate clutter and other potential hiding places for centipedes.

  3. 3

    Seal entry points

    Use caulk or other sealants to close any cracks, crevices, or other openings that centipedes may use to enter your home.

  4. 4

    Consider DIY treatments

    For minor infestations, you may be able to use over-the-counter pesticides or natural repellents to eliminate centipedes. Follow the instructions carefully.

  5. 5

    Call a professional

    If the problem persists or you have a severe infestation, contact a licensed pest control technician for more effective and long-lasting solutions.

Frequently Asked Questions

How can I prevent centipedes from entering my home?

To prevent centipedes, focus on reducing moisture and eliminating their food sources. Seal cracks and crevices, fix any leaks, and keep the home clean and dry.

What are the signs of a centipede infestation?

Signs of a centipede infestation include seeing the insects themselves, as well as their shed exoskeletons or egg sacs. You may also notice small bite marks or other damage caused by the centipedes.

When should I call a professional pest control technician?

If you have a severe or persistent centipede problem, it's best to call a professional pest control technician. They can identify the root cause, use targeted treatments, and provide long-term solutions to eliminate the infestation.
